Subject: Fareloom cut-over complete

Team — the switch from the legacy surcharge tables to the Fareloom rules engine finished last night without customer-visible errors. Shadow evaluation ran for two weeks and matched legacy output on 99.97% of quotes; the remainder were known rounding fixes. For future reference, the production instance now runs with the following configuration values.

settings of fafog-haduf:
ZORIX_PIN=4648
ZORIX_METRICS_HOST=metrics.zorix.paliqsys.corp
ZORIX_LOG_LEVEL=info
ZORIX_TENANT=druix

Onboarding — Training Video Studio (Room 4.12)

All new starters at Quillbrook record a short intro video during their first month. The studio is on the fourth floor, past the breakout kitchen. Book a slot through the Fenwick scheduler; sessions run 30 minutes, and the lights and camera rig are preset — don't adjust them. Headsets and clip mics live in the grey drawer. The studio door stays locked outside sessions, so let yourself in with the code below.

door code, yagap-bahof: bdg-O-05

## Welcome to PickPath

New to the crew? PickPath is Cartwheel Logistics' pick-list optimizer — it reorders warehouse pick tasks so runners walk less and bins empty faster. You'll mostly touch the routing scorer and the aisle-congestion model. Don't worry about the legacy batcher; it's frozen until next quarter. Local setup takes about twenty minutes, and the test fixtures mimic our Northgate warehouse layout. Setup steps, architecture sketches, and the glossary live on our internal page.

dashboard of bafof-hafog = https://confluence.lumiclabs.internal/display/browse/display/6a09a20a

### Changed defaults — Quillcheck 3.0

SQL linting is now enforced at commit time rather than in CI only. Rules for keyword casing and implicit joins moved from warning to error, which will block releases containing legacy-style migrations. Repos can suppress rules per file until the cleanup sprint lands. The enforced default rule configuration is listed below.

service settings:
novath:
  pin: 1396
  tenant: pelys
  seal: seal_ccc035e1
  metrics_host: metrics.novath.qorvelworks.test
  standby_team: fraeth
  escalation: drueth-zorok
  nonce: 61d508